Output 12958cc5814d8e747132641bbd99aee1585a40271221594faca82a986d69e598:9

value
20000
script pubkey
OP_0 OP_PUSHBYTES_20 ce0ec09b300795f50cd8c1fad069811446ca99be
address
tb1qec8vpxesq72l2rxcc8adq6vpz3rv4xd75apm78
transaction
12958cc5814d8e747132641bbd99aee1585a40271221594faca82a986d69e598